Now is a good time to review sales, review project progress, review your systems and put it all down on a spreadsheet or paper so that you can do the same again in another 3 months.
Don't forget to set some deadlines, review your vision and give yourself a pat on the back for your progress so far.
Benchmarking – reviewing and making note of the things that you HAVE done can be an excellent way to give yourself inspiration and to pick up in plenty of time, the areas where you may be lagging behind. It's a good thing for everyone to do on a regular basis.
Daily, Weekly, Monthly Quarterly and Yearly is not too much.
